10-year-old Nigerian Writer Releases Inspirational Book To Help Young Ones Pursue Their Dreams (Photos)

Posted by Thandiubani on Thu 04th Jun, 2020 - tori.ng

A 10-year-old Nigerian writer has released her latest book to encourage young ones pursue their dreams.

Okpo
Obonganwan Itam Okpo
 
An intelligent Nigerian girl, Obonganwan Itam Okpo has made a mark for herself after publishing a 36-page book at the age of 10.
 
Okpo who is a primary 5 student of Santa Maria International Nursery and Primary school, has shared an insight about her latest book titled 'Life Is A Journey'.
 
Okpo shared the following interesting details about her latest book with TORI.NG.
 
According to her, the book sheds light on important issues of life as we journey through to get to our different goals in life. 
 
"It is made up of 15 chapters which are: Chapter 1- First Steps To Take For Your Journey, Chapter 2- Passing Through Struggles of Life, Chapter 3- Avoiding Problems Stopping You from completing Your Journey, Chapter 4- Helping Others to Start Their Journey, Chapter 5- Seeing The Wonderful Experiences in Life, Chapter 6- The Frustrations and Disappointments in Life, Chapter 7- Controlling The Love of Money in Your Journey, Chapter 8- Making Decisions in Life, Chapter 9- Setting The Proper Goals in Life, Chapter 10- Overcoming Temptations in Life, Chapter 11- Applying Wisdom, Chapter 12- Being Disciplined in Life, Chapter 13- Being Well Focused in Life, Chapter 14- Being Grateful in Life and Chapter 15- Conclusion." Okpo stated.
 
 
The book is solely Obonganwan's work and is very encouraging for both parents and children to develop more faith and put to good use their God's given abilities.
 
Okpo's book reminds all to believe more in our children and not despise their wisdom because it is surprising that such a little girl can understand so much about life in her few years of existence on earth.
